N4976F is a 1980 Cessna 172N.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 4 seats, powered by a Lycoming 0-320 series rated at 180 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in Anaheim, CA.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Jan 1995. It has been registered to its current owner since Apr 1995.

About the Cessna 172N

About the model

A late-1970s Skyhawk variant, four-seat and high-wing. Widely used for primary training; the type is common enough that parts and instruction are available almost anywhere.
